Serpent's Tooth by Faye Kellerman
Serpent's Tooth
Serpent's Tooth

Publisher: Simon & Schuster Audio
Author: Faye Kellerman
Audio lenght: 5 hours and 24 min.

A lone gunman walks into a trendy L.A. restaurant, and seconds later a terrifying mass murder transforms it into a slaughterhouse. Even Lieutenant Peter Decker, with over 20 years of law enforcement experience, is horrified at the sight of the dead and injured. The shooter, now dead, is identified as former bartender and struggling actor Harlan Manz. After the tragedy, the media describe Manz as a psycho and the families want closure on the case. However, Decker is not satisfied with the obvious information, and he begins to relentlessly pursue the crime, searching for another explanation or another killer. He is thrust into the lurid world of moneyed Southern California, where everything can be bought. Soon after he enters this labyrinth, his reputation comes under fire, but this only inspires him to forge ahead and uncover the truth.
